APPARATUS USING FREE VORTEX FLOW, e.g. CYCLONES ([N: centrifugal separation of water from steam F22B37/32;] jet mills B02C19/06; [N: wind sifters B07B7/00;] cyclonic type combustion apparatus F23; [N: vortex burners for cyclone-type combustion apparatus F23D1/02; cyclonic type combustion apparatus for gas turbines F23R3/00 ])
Definition statement
This subclass/group covers:
Apparatus for separating or like treating (e.g. drying, extracting, purifying) in which centrifugal or centripetal effects are generated by free vortex flow, otherwise than by rotary bowls, rotors or curved passages. The free vortex flow generated may follow a flat spiral, have an unchanged or constant axial direction, or have a reversible axial direction.

Apparatus in which the main direction of flow follows a flat spiral ; [N: so-called flat cyclones or vortex chambers]
Definition statement
This subclass/group covers:
Flat cyclones or vortex chambers and cyclones where the inlet extends substantially over the whole height of the vortex chamber.

Apparatus in which the axial direction of the vortex [N: (flow following a screw-thread type line)] remains unchanged [N: Also devices in which one of the two discharge ducts returns centrally through the vortex chamber, a reverse-flow vortex being prevented by bulkheads in the central discharge duct (combined with other devices B04C9/00 )]
Definition statement
This subclass/group covers:
Cyclones where the direction of flow does not change, the fluid enters the cyclone on an upstream side and the separated phases are discharged on the downstream side.
Apparatus in which the axial direction of the vortex is reversed [N: (combined with other devices B04C9/00 )]
Definition statement
This subclass/group covers:
Cyclones where the axial direction of the lighter fluid is reversed. The direction of flow does change, the fluid enters the cyclone on an upstream side and the separated heavier fluid is discharged on the downstream side, the lighter fluid travels back to the upstream side of the cyclone.
Multiple arrangement thereof [N: (combination types according to other groups, B04C7/00 )]
Definition statement
This subclass/group covers:
Combinations of reverse flow cyclones of series flow and parallel flow where the features of the interactive connection are important.

Combinations with other devices, e.g. fans, [N: expansion chambers, diffusors, water locks] (with filters B01D50/00 )
Definition statement
This subclass/group covers:
Combinations of cyclones with expansion chambers, diffusors, water locks or sieves.
Combinations of cyclones with internally or externally arranged rotors like fans, ventilators, blowers, impellers, pumps.
Combinations of cyclones with internally or externally arranged filters.
Combinations of cyclones with electrostatic separation equipment.
Cyclones with injection or suction of liquid or gas into the cyclone chamber.
